Louisiana State Police investigate a crash that killed 53-year-old Terry Ralph of Boutte.
The single-car crash happened on US 90 west near Live Oak Boulevard early Tuesday morning.
State police say that Ralph was driving a 2018 Chevrolet pickup truck towing an enclosed trailer west on US 90 near Live Oak Boulevard. For reasons still under investigation, the Chevrolet traveled off the roadway to the right and impacted a guardrail before traveling into a drainage canal, where it became partially submerged.
Ralph, who was unrestrained suffered fatal injuries and was pronounced dead at the scene.
Impairment on the part of Ralph is unknown and routine toxicology results are pending.
